#171311 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#171311 is composed of 9% red, 7.5% green and 6.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 17.4% magenta, 26.1% yellow and 91% black. It has a hue angle of 20 degrees, a saturation of 15% and a lightness of 7.8%. #171311 color hex could be obtained by blending #2e2622 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000000.

Shades and Tints of #171311
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f7f5f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#171311
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#151413 is the less saturated color, while #280d00 is the most saturated one.
